I should also note that ethernet uses pins 1, 2, 3, and 6 on the RJ45
connector but the LF1S022 makes these connections internally. If you
look at the datasheet, it shows how these connections are made from
the pins to the RG45 through the transformers. I also realized that
there is not a schematic for the PoE version (PU1S041XB) which I
believe is what you have. Until you get the internal schematic for
this connector, there is really no way to know how to hook it up.
Several months ago, I considered using these (because of the included
LED's) but I could not find out how to connect it so I just stuck
with the LF1S022.
